When tragedy strikes the Carey-Lewis take Judith in and together they deal with the loves and losses as Britain enters the war. It is at the boarding school that Judith meets Loveday Carey-Lewis (Poppy Gaye, Katie Ryder Richardson) whose wealthy family live in Nancherrow, an impressive house in the middle of its own estate. ![]() ![]() ![]() It's the autumn of 1936 and with her parents working in Singapore young Judith Dubar (Keira Knightley, Emily Mortimer) finds herself at a boarding school in Cornwall near to where her aunt Louise (Penelope Keith) lives. ![]()
